Introduction to Plantain
Plantain, also known as Plantago major, is a perennial herb native to Europe and Asia but now found in many parts of the world. It is characterized by its broad, flat leaves that grow from a central rosette and can produce tall flower spikes in the summer months. The plant has been a staple in traditional medicine for its anti-inflammatory, antimicrobial, and antiseptic properties, making it an effective treatment for various health conditions.
Chemical Composition of Plantain
The therapeutic properties of plantain are attributed to its rich chemical composition, which includes:
– Alkaloids: These compounds are known for their anti-inflammatory and antimicrobial actions.
– Flavonoids: They possess antioxidant properties, which help protect the body against free radicals.
– Glycosides: These compounds are responsible for the plant’s anti-inflammatory and antimicrobial effects.
– Terpenes: They contribute to the plant’s antimicrobial and antifungal properties.
– Mucilages: These are polysaccharides that form a protective gel-like layer on the skin and mucous membranes, aiding in wound healing and soothing irritated tissues.
Traditional Uses of Plantain
Traditionally, plantain has been used in various ways to treat different health issues:
– Topical application for skinconditions such as wounds, burns, eczema, and acne.
– Oral consumption as a tea or infusion to treat digestive problems, respiratory infections, and as a diuretic.
– The leaves can be applied directly to the skin as a poultice to treat snake bites, insect stings, and minor cuts and scrapes.

Preparation of Plantain Tea
To prepare plantain tea, follow these steps:
– Dry the plantain leaves thoroughly to preserve them for future use.
– Use one tablespoon of dried plantain leaves for every cup of boiling water.
– Steep the leaves in the boiling water for 5-10 minutes.
– Strain the tea and drink it warm, up to three times a day.

Are there any potential side effects or interactions associated with using plantain for infection treatment and prevention?
While plantain is generally considered safe to use, there are potential side effects and interactions that should be taken into consideration. Plantain can cause allergic reactions in some individuals, particularly those with sensitivities to plants in the same family. Additionally, plantain can interact with certain medications, such as blood thinners and diabetes medications, and may exacerbate underlying health conditions, such as kidney or liver disease.
To minimize the risk of side effects and interactions, it is essential to consult with a healthcare professional before using plantain for infection treatment and prevention. Individuals with underlying health conditions or taking medications should exercise caution when using plantain, and monitor their health closely for any adverse effects. Furthermore, plantain should not be used as a replacement for conventional medical treatment, but rather as a complementary therapy to support overall health and well-being. By being aware of the potential side effects and interactions associated with plantain, individuals can use it safely and effectively to prevent and treat infections.
